The 350 Small Block in the Square Body Service Truck got freshly gapped rings and a rotating assemble that is way out of balance. The rings were gapped to 0.024" on the top ring and 0.026" on the second ring, which is what is specified for up to 15 psi of boost. I had to replace one piston because it was a victim of gravity. The new piston and pin was about 80 grams lighter than the piston it replaced (it weighed 666 grams, so there's that). So the rotating assembly is a bit out of balance. I could replace the entire set of pistons, but this is a budget build, so I'll just send it. Which...that'll be fine...probably.
